MANY HAPPY RETURNS (Or at least two of them!)

SCOTLAND boss Gregor Townsend has been handed a massive Six Nations boost with Glasgow pair Jack Dempsey and Kyle Steyn fit for selection.

Toony names his squad this afternoon and has been fretting over a number of injury doubts among the contenders.

Back-rower Dempsey has played only once since the World Cup after undergoing surgery on a fractured bone in his skull.

And winger Steyn has been sidelined with an ankle problem that has kept him out of action since October.

But the duo have both been declared available for Warriors' Champions Cup clash with Toulon on Friday.

And Glasgow defence coach Pete Murchie reckons that has to be good news for Scotland too. He said: "Jack and Kyle have both got a chance of featuring this week for us. Both of them are available.
